| Industry | Application | Process |
|---|---|---|
| Pharmaceutical R&D | Serves as a synthetic intermediate for preparing proline-containing drug molecules, including antiviral agents, anticancer agents, and peptide-based therapeutics | Introduced as a BOC-protected methylene-proline unit into target peptide chains via solid-phase or liquid-phase peptide synthesis (SPPS/LPPS) |
| Peptide Chemistry | Used to synthesize non-natural amino acid-modified peptides featuring cyclic or rigid structures | Incorporated as a specialized amino acid residue during peptide chain elongation to enhance metabolic stability or conformational constraint |
| Organic Synthesis | Serves as a chiral building block for constructing complex heterocyclic compounds or natural product analogs | Undergoes selective deprotection and coupling reactions leveraging its BOC-protected secondary amine and carboxylic acid functional groups |
| Detection Item | Common Analytical Method | Method Overview |
|---|---|---|
| Assay (Purity) | HPLC-UV | Quantifies main component using reversed-phase HPLC with UV detection at 210 nm based on peak area comparison against reference standard. |
| Related Substances | HPLC-UV | Detects and quantifies structurally related impurities using gradient HPLC-UV; identification via retention time matching and threshold-based reporting. |
| Residual Solvents | GC-FID | Measures volatile organic solvents (e.g., ethyl acetate, toluene) by gas chromatography with flame ionization detection using headspace sampling. |
| Water Content | Karl Fischer Titration | Determines trace water via coulometric or volumetric titration using iodine generation and stoichiometric reaction with water. |
| Heavy Metals | ICP-MS | Quantifies elemental impurities (e.g., Pb, Cd, Ni) after acid digestion using inductively coupled plasma mass spectrometry for ultra-trace detection. |
| Chloride Content | Ion Chromatography | Separates and quantifies chloride ions using suppressed conductivity detection after aqueous extraction. |
| Optical Rotation | [alpha]D Measurement | Measures specific optical rotation using sodium D-line light source to confirm chiral integrity and enantiomeric purity. |
| Melting Point | Capillary Melting Point Apparatus | Determines temperature range of solid-to-liquid transition using calibrated capillary apparatus per USP <741>. |
| Residue on Ignition | Gravimetric Analysis | Quantifies inorganic ash content by high-temperature incineration followed by precise weighing of residual residue. |
| Particle Size Distribution | Laser Diffraction | Measures particle size distribution in dry or dispersed state using Mie scattering theory and laser diffraction principle. |
| pH of Aqueous Suspension | Potentiometric pH Measurement | Determines pH of 1% w/v suspension in water using calibrated glass electrode and pH meter. |
| Microbial Limits | Membrane Filtration | Quantifies aerobic microorganisms and detects specified pathogens (e.g., E. coli) via membrane filtration followed by agar culture and colony enumeration. |
